Material NIRMI Pure
If we take something from nature, we want to do it as gently as possible. For us, this means using natural materials that are as regional as possible:
- Outer fabric: 100% linen from European cultivation (France, Belgium, Netherlands), woven in Austria by the Vieböck weaving mill in the Mühlviertel, finished and dyed in the Waldviertel.
- Filling: 100% wool from Tyrolean Steinschaf, made in Austria in the Haslach manufactory.
- Webbing: 100% cotton, woven in Austria by the Silberbauer band weaving mill and in the Czech Republic by the Pega weaving mill.
- Pull-in rubber bands: made of cotton (Turkey) and natural rubber (Malaysia), woven in Austria, made up in Germany by Charle in Berlin.
- All labels and textile labels: 100% cotton.
Where there is no equivalent alternative for safety reasons, we prefer recycled plastic:
- Buckles: Nylon (recycled) from Italy by 2emme.
- Sewing thread: Polyester (100% recycled) from Germany by Amann.

sewing
Fairly sewn in the tailor shop of the NGO ANKAA in Athens, which gives refugee tailors a permanent job and teaches people who are threatened by unemployment or who have had refugee experience the necessary skills for the job market.

our prices
We are a social start-up , which means that the top priority is not maximizing profit, but maximizing social impact: in other words, enabling the textile artisans to earn a fair income through the sale of patches.
Our prices start at €265 depending on the patch. That sounds high at first glance. However, this is the lowest calculated price at which we can pay the textile artisans fairly, process regional natural materials from Europe and still be able to keep up with the competition.

Who made your NIRMI?
ANKAA is a Luxembourgish-Greek NGO that operates a center for education and a social business textile workshop in Athens, aimed at supporting people affected by unemployment and displacement. ANKAA provides training in sewing, Greek language, and other skills to promote employment inclusion. In the workshop, skilled seamstresses with a refugee background can find long-term employment, enabling sustainable brands such as NIRMI to achieve ethical production. The income generated from these collaborations also supports ANKAA's educational programs.
